Quick Summary

Cases

Cases is an exclusive in-house game that repackages the popular case-opening online format into a fast-paced crypto casino game. This style of game has its roots in early 2010s video games, such as CS:GO skin trading cases and FIFA card packs. While the idea has been adapted for casinos before, MetaWin Studios has become one of the few to publish full prize tiers.

What is Cases?

This case-opening crypto game works around a random prize reveal mechanic. Players select a case, open it, and discover what reward from the drop table they receive. Cases is a part of the MetaWin Originals selection, a series of games that lean into crypto-friendly formats. It sticks closely to the minimal UI and clean visuals of other popular Originals games.

Cases has a clean black interface that shows the game window with colored cases ready to open, with betting options sitting to the left. All gameplay features are within sight and just one click or tap away. Cases feels direct, focusing on delivering gameplay without much fuss or hidden features.

However, it is also stylish, with each round showing a visual opening animation that helps add to the anticipation. Rewards tiers are shown at the bottom of the screen, where you can see the multiplier amount and the chance of winning it. The pacing is intentionally dramatic, giving even smaller openings a sense of momentum while premium hits feel more like an event.

Low-stakes cases have modest payouts, but they can drop more often, while high-stakes cases have more volatility but bigger overall payouts. You get a real sense that there is a progression built into the game, allowing you to choose how to balance risk vs reward. Underpinning the whole game is the provably fair RNG system that ensures fair outcomes that players can verify themselves.

You find Cases in the MetaWin Originals lineup in the game lobby, which is closely linked with MetaWin Packs. Both games are reveal-driven instead of focusing on grid or slot-style mechanics.

Cases Features and Mechanics

The basic rules are only one part of knowing how to play Cases because there are also features that enhance the overall gameplay. The standard loop of the game is straightforward and includes choosing a case, opening it, and seeing the reveal of a random reward. However, the depth comes from MetaWin Casino's structure that focuses on volatility choices.

Lower-level cases generally feature more affordable entry prices and more common outcomes, while premium cases increase volatility by concentrating more value into a smaller number of rare drops. The game is an example of casino gameplay that focuses on risk profile more than on built-in bonus features.

Every case has its own weighted RNG distribution. All possible rewards in a case have a predefined rarity weighting that decides the reward. While this is standard for all casino case opening games, Cases is backed by MetaWin Casino's ironclad provably fair system.

Each round is given a hidden server seed, client seed, and nonce. The server seed is set in-house, but nobody can tamper with it once it is set. You have the option to use an automatic client seed or set one yourself. The nonce acts as a counter for the number of rounds. This allows you to check all results using the built-in SHA-256 tool or independently to verify that outcomes are fair.

You'll find features that are designed for playing over longer sessions. Auto-open allows you to set a stake for repeated case reveals instead of manually restarting after each round. There is a history log that shows all the previous drops and outcomes. MetaWin Studios also periodically rotates limited-edition or seasonal cases tied to events, promotions, or themed collections, giving regular players new prize ladders and rarity distributions beyond the permanent catalog.

Cases RTP and Volatility

Cases RTP is towards the higher end of crypto-friendly casino games at 98%, sticking to the higher-return structure that the MetaWin Originals collection is known for. The game has a higher RTP than most slots, and higher than other Originals titles such as Bars and Plinko. This is because the volatility is built into the game for players to choose instead of being tied to bonus mechanics.

This means there is also big win potential from Cases, with a top multiplier of 10,000x and a max payout cap of $250,000. With the house edge and possibility of high-paying drops, along with options for lower volatility play, Cases works well for budget players and higher rollers.

One of the game's biggest transparency advantages is that the full prize ladder and rarity weighting are publicly visible before opening a case. Players can see the available outcomes and associated probabilities upfront, which makes the experience far more transparent than many third-party skin-trading or loot-box style platforms.

Tips for playing Cases

While this is a simple game, there are Cases strategies and tips you can use to get the most potential from your sessions.

  1. Always look at the prize ladder before you open the case. The ladder shows transparent published odds that highlight the rarity and payout structure of the case. Two similarly-priced cases can reveal very different rewards through the volatility profile.
  2. Premium cases can deliver big win potential, but treat them as high-variance play instead of a guaranteed upgrade. Most of the time, your biggest drops will come from small probability, expensive cases, so use them for occasional hits instead of steady play.
  3. Decide how many cases you'll open before you start playing. This is a game that has fast rounds, especially if you're using the auto option. It is better to structure your play instead of playing on emotion.
  4. Use the provably fair verification system regularly. Since every drop is generated through seed-based RNG, checking results through the fairness tool helps confirm that outcomes were legitimately generated before the reveal animation began.
  5. Stick to the case tier that matches your budget and intended session size. Lower-tier cases usually provide a steadier play and allow you to stay in sessions longer.
